A-level and AS-level students congratulated in Pembrokeshire

Llongyfarch myfyrwyr Safon Uwch a Safon UG yn Sir Benfro

Pembrokeshire County Council congratulates all A-level, AS-level and vocational learners who are receiving results today.

The past three and half years have been some of the most challenging in recent times for these learners. Determination, resilience and the ability to adapt in challenging times reflect the additional skills required by learners who have received results today.

Cabinet Member for Education and the Welsh Language Cllr Guy Woodham said: “We congratulate all learners on their achievements.

“Continuing the transition back in to external examinations has been a challenge that these learners have met successfully.

“The achievements of learners are to be commended and celebrated. I would like to wish them every success for their futures.”

Director for Education Steven Richards-Downes said, “All learners will receive results today that open up new possibilities for them.

“We recognise the major challenges that they have faced and how they have overcome them through determination, hard work and the support from education staff.

“Their commitment and that of education staff has been remarkable. I wish every learner continued happiness and success.

“We thank also today the families of students who have supported them through a very challenging period in their lives.

“We hope that all learners are able to proceed to the next phase of their lives or education with purpose, dignity and pride.”
